diff options
author | kib <kib@FreeBSD.org> | 2017-09-13 11:19:04 +0000 |
---|---|---|
committer | Luiz Souza <luiz@netgate.com> | 2018-02-21 15:17:32 -0300 |
commit | 44d43dcf1789fec27f271fe4e9175e1a297736d9 (patch) | |
tree | 0adb5a8c26be2fee62912e52e90fddd6b917de73 /contrib/llvm/lib/Bitcode | |
parent | 62bbacd241ac55321158bc2e1eb38d4bd46be6c6 (diff) | |
download | FreeBSD-src-44d43dcf1789fec27f271fe4e9175e1a297736d9.zip FreeBSD-src-44d43dcf1789fec27f271fe4e9175e1a297736d9.tar.gz |
MFC r322913:
Replace global swhash in swap pager with per-object trie to track swap
blocks assigned to the object pages.
MFC r322970 (by alc):
Do not call vm_pager_page_unswapped() on the fast fault path.
MFC r322971 (by alc):
Update a couple vm_object lock assertions in the swap pager.
MFC r323224:
In swp_pager_meta_build(), handle a race with other thread allocating
swapblk for our index while we dropped the object lock.
MFC r323226:
Do not leak empty swblk.
(cherry picked from commit 36d113490a64de94e4172f3d916e74d8eff5b7db)
Diffstat (limited to 'contrib/llvm/lib/Bitcode')
0 files changed, 0 insertions, 0 deletions